I'm getting the following error every time I try to schedule a block
reservation. Does anyone know what this means?
Can't use string ("0") as a HASH ref while "strict refs" in use at
/usr/local/vcl/bin/../lib/VCL/blockrequest.pm line 160.
Time: 2009-10-26 08:19:05
PID: 7500
Caller: vcld:die_handler(662)
( 0) utils.pm, notify (line: 737)
(-1) vcld, die_handler (line: 662)
(-2) blockrequest.pm, process (line: 160)
(-3) vcld, make_new_child (line: 594)
(-4) vcld, main (line: 442)
RECENT LOG ENTRIES FOR THIS PROCESS:
2009-10-26 08:19:05|7500|vcld:make_new_child(582)|vcld environment variable set
to 0 for this process
2009-10-26 08:19:05|7500|blockrequest|Module.pm:new(132)|constructor called,
class=VCL::blockrequest
2009-10-26 08:19:05|7500|blockrequest|Module.pm:new(154)|VCL::blockrequest
object created
2009-10-26 08:19:05|7500|blockrequest|blockrequest.pm:initialize(84)|obtained a
database handle for this state process, stored as $ENV{dbh}
2009-10-26
08:19:05|7500|blockrequest|utils.pm:rename_vcld_process(7901)|renamed process
to 'vcld VCL::blockrequest 15:19 'Test''
2009-10-26 08:19:05|7500|blockrequest|blockrequest.pm:initialize(97)|returning 1
2009-10-26
08:19:05|7500|blockrequest|vcld:make_new_child(591)|VCL::blockrequest object
created and initialized
2009-10-26 08:19:05|7500|blockrequest|blockrequest.pm:process(141)|blockrequest
id: 15
2009-10-26 08:19:05|7500|blockrequest|blockrequest.pm:process(142)|blockrequest
mode: start
2009-10-26 08:19:05|7500|blockrequest|blockrequest.pm:process(143)|blockrequest
image id: 258
2009-10-26 08:19:05|7500|blockrequest|blockrequest.pm:process(144)|blockrequest
number machines: 5
2009-10-26 08:19:05|7500|blockrequest|blockrequest.pm:process(145)|blockrequest
expire: 2009-10-26 11:30:00
2009-10-26 08:19:05|7500|blockrequest|blockrequest.pm:process(146)|blocktime
id: 19
2009-10-26 08:19:05|7500|blockrequest|blockrequest.pm:process(147)|blocktime
processed: 0
2009-10-26 08:19:05|7500|blockrequest|blockrequest.pm:process(148)|blocktime
start: 2009-10-26 10:30:00
2009-10-26 08:19:05|7500|blockrequest|blockrequest.pm:process(149)|blocktime
end: 2009-10-26 11:30:00
2009-10-26 08:19:05|7500|blockrequest|blockrequest.pm:process(154)|updated
process flag on blocktime_id= 19
2009-10-26 08:19:05|7500|blockrequest|utils.pm:process_block_time(9831)|calling
xmlrpc_call with method= XMLRPCprocessBlockTime
2009-10-26 08:19:05|7500|blockrequest|utils.pm:xmlrpc_call(9881)|in
xmlrpc_call: method= XMLRPCprocessBlockTime args= 19
|7500|blockrequest| ---- WARNING ----
|7500|blockrequest| 2009-10-26 08:19:05|7500|blockrequest|utils.pm:xmlrpc_call(9891)|fault occured on XMLRPCprocessBlockTime,19
|7500|blockrequest| faultCode=
RPC::XML::fault=HASH(0x1ec6a430)->code->{faultCode}
|7500|blockrequest| faultString=
RPC::XML::fault=HASH(0x1ec6a430)->string->{faultString}
|7500|blockrequest| ( 0) utils.pm, notify (line: 737)
|7500|blockrequest| (-1) utils.pm, xmlrpc_call (line: 9891)
|7500|blockrequest| (-2) utils.pm, process_block_time (line: 9833)
|7500|blockrequest| (-3) blockrequest.pm, process (line: 158)
|7500|blockrequest| (-4) vcld, make_new_child (line: 594)
|7500|blockrequest| (-5) vcld, main (line: 442)
|7500|blockrequest| ---- WARNING ----
|7500|blockrequest| 2009-10-26 08:19:05|7500|blockrequest|utils.pm:process_block_time(9851)|return argument XMLRPCprocessBlockTime was not a STRUCT as expected
|7500|blockrequest| ( 0) utils.pm, notify (line: 737)
|7500|blockrequest| (-1) utils.pm, process_block_time (line: 9851)
|7500|blockrequest| (-2) blockrequest.pm, process (line: 158)
|7500|blockrequest| (-3) vcld, make_new_child (line: 594)
|7500|blockrequest| (-4) vcld, main (line: 442)
--
Mike Waldron
Systems Specialist
ITS Research Computing
University of North Carolina at Chapel Hill
CB #3420, ITS Manning, Rm 2509
Office: 919-962-9778